#!/usr/bin/env bash
set -e
echo "==================================="
echo "9Launcher Release Creator"
echo "==================================="
echo ""
# Get current version from CMakeLists.txt or ask user
echo "Enter the new version number (e.g., 0.0.3):"
read -r VERSION
# Validate version format
if [[ ! "$VERSION" =~ ^[0-9]+\.[0-9]+\.[0-9]+$ ]]; then
echo "Error: Version must be in format X.Y.Z (e.g., 0.0.3)"
exit 1
fi
TAG="v${VERSION}"
# Check if tag already exists
if git rev-parse "$TAG" >/dev/null 2>&1; then
echo "Error: Tag $TAG already exists!"
exit 1
fi
echo ""
echo "Enter release title (press Enter to use default: '9Launcher ${VERSION}'):"
read -r RELEASE_TITLE
if [ -z "$RELEASE_TITLE" ]; then
RELEASE_TITLE="9Launcher ${VERSION}"
fi
echo ""
echo "Would you like to create custom release notes? (y/n)"
read -r CREATE_NOTES
if [[ "$CREATE_NOTES" =~ ^[Yy]$ ]]; then
echo ""
echo "Opening editor for release notes..."
echo "# Release Notes for ${TAG}" > R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"## What's Changed"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"### New Features"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"- " >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"### Bug Fixes"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"- " >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"### Other Changes"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"- " >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"## Download" >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
echo "Choose the appropriate file for your platform below." >> RELEASE_NOTES.md
# Open in editor (try various editors)
if command -v "${EDITOR:-nano}" &> /dev/null; then
"${EDITOR:-nano}" RELEASE_NOTES.md
elif command -v nano &> /dev/null; then
nano RELEASE_NOTES.md
elif command -v vim &> /dev/null; then
vim RELEASE_NOTES.md
elif command -v vi &> /dev/null; then
vi RELEASE_NOTES.md
else
echo "No suitable editor found. Please edit RELEASE_NOTES.md manually."
exit 1
fi
echo ""
echo "Release notes saved to RELEASE_NOTES.md"
# Ask if user wants to commit the release notes
echo ""
echo "Commit RELEASE_NOTES.md? (y/n)"
read -r COMMIT_NOTES
if [[ "$COMMIT_NOTES" =~ ^[Yy]$ ]]; then
git add RELEASE_NOTES.md
git commit -m "Add release notes for ${TAG}"
fi
else
# Remove RELEASE_NOTES.md if it exists to use auto-generated notes
if [ -f "RELEASE_NOTES.md" ]; then
rm RELEASE_NOTES.md
fi
echo "Using auto-generated release notes"
fi
echo ""
echo "==================================="
echo "Summary:"
echo " Version: ${VERSION}"
echo " Tag: ${TAG}"
echo " Title: ${RELEASE_TITLE}"
if [ -f "RELEASE_NOTES.md" ]; then
echo " Notes: Custom (RELEASE_NOTES.md)"
else
echo " Notes: Auto-generated"
fi
echo "==================================="
echo ""
echo "Ready to create release. This will:"
echo " 1. Create and push tag ${TAG}"
echo " 2. Trigger GitHub Actions to build artifacts"
echo " 3. Create GitHub release with artifacts"
echo ""
echo "Continue? (y/n)"
read -r CONFIRM
if [[ ! "$CONFIRM" =~ ^[Yy]$ ]]; then
echo "Cancelled."
exit 0
fi
# Create and push tag
echo ""
echo "Creating tag ${TAG}..."
git tag -a "$TAG" -m "$RELEASE_TITLE"
echo "Pushing tag to origin..."
git push origin "$TAG"
echo ""
echo "==================================="
echo "Release ${TAG} created!"
echo "==================================="
echo ""
echo "GitHub Actions will now build the artifacts and create the release."
echo "You can monitor the progress at:"
echo "https://github.com/$(git config --get remote.origin.url | sed 's/.*://;s/.git$//')/actions"
echo ""
echo "After the build completes, the release will be available at:"
echo "https://github.com/$(git config --get remote.origin.url | sed 's/.*://;s/.git$//')/releases/tag/${TAG}"
